Snack Time /Amser Snac

We have snack time every morning.  Children are invited to bring one healthy snack to eat at snack time (e.g. a piece of fruit or sticks of vegetables).  For safety reasons, if children bring grapes for snack, these must be cut in half.  Please send your child's snack in a sealed pot or food bag clearly labelled with their name to avoid confusion.  Children are also encouraged to bring a bottle of water to keep in class to drink throughout the day.

 

 

PE

Dosbarth Oren have PE lessons every Wednesday.  Children can wear PE kit to school (black/navy joggers or leggings, white t-shirt and school jumper or cardigan).  For safety reasons, please remove all jewellery before coming to school on PE days.  

 

 

Homework

 Year 1 children are provided with sound boards to practise their phonic skills at home and, when they are ready, will also bring home a reading book.  Please try to practise these for a few minutes a day.  They will also be given a reading record book, please use this to write down how your child is getting on with their sounds / reading at home.

Class Dojo

This year, Year 1 has begun using Class Dojo to keep families up to date with what is going on in school and to motivate children to perform to the best of their ability.  We share photos and videos of class activities and invite parents/carers to celebrate our successes with us.  Children have loved designing their own monsters and earning dojo points for positive behaviours.  They collect points to meet individual and class targets and win prizes as rewards for their efforts.

Learning can be Messy!

 

Please be aware that our little learners will get messy in school.  We do ensure children wear aprons but when you're little and exploring, mess can get everywhere!  We ask that you do not put your best clothes or coats on for school just in case!
